These studies illustrate the complex problem of the nature of noble gas transfer in basins. There is no doubt that both advection and diffusion play major roles, but the respective strengths of each process are very different depending on the scale of observa- [Pg.590]

The problem is much more difficult in the case of semi-permeable or even impermeable layers such as shales or marls where the connectivity between pockets of interstitial water is uncertain and difficult to evaluate from laboratory measurements. [Pg.591]
